Publishing a non-fiction book today requires far more than simply writing well. Authors are increasingly expected to understand audience, positioning, platform, credibility, and commercial viability alongside the craft itself.
This WiPS panel brings together voices from publishing, psychology, leadership, and author entrepreneurship to explore what it really takes to move a non-fiction book from concept to market.
Whether you’re developing an idea, considering self-publishing, building a proposal, or trying to understand what agents and publishers are really looking for, this session offers an honest and practical look inside modern non-fiction publishing.
You’ll hear from:
Marysia Juszczakiewicz, literary agent and publisher with decades of international publishing experience
Dr Bee Lim, author and clinical psychologist, whose work explores trauma, identity, silence, and healing
Veronica Llorca-Smith, author, speaker, and founder of a global writing and creator community
Moderated by:
Imogen Short, storytelling strategist, fiction and non-fiction author, and moderator
